Develops, writes, and edits material for reports, manuals, briefs, proposals, instruction books, and related environmental and scientific publications. May supervise a team of writers and act in a lead capacity if needed. Provides helpdesk support via phone and email to users of an accounting/travel information system. Conducts interviews with applicable sources; researches various sources to gain knowledge on subject from subject matter experts. Organizes materials and completes writing assignments with regard to order, clarity, conciseness, style, and terminology. Possesses ability to write in various styles and to a variety of audiences (i.e., scientific, newsletter, general public, etc.); writing of occasional Broadcast announcements. Responsible for proof-reading (for grammar), sending out bulletins about UFMS updates, training, and changes. Sets up quarterly virtual meetings to update fiscal staff around the world about any updates, clarification on new processes or policies, or fielding questions (in advance) about various updates and topics. Edits travel communications including bulletins, SOPs, QRGs (quick reference guides), and possible Broadcast announcements. Edits information and hardcopy documentation; ensures proper cross-referencing occurs. Ensures material is presented in a user-friendly manner. Coordinates the display of graphics. Ensures all applicable guidelines for indexing are followed. Minimum experience and education required: Position requires Bachelor’s degree and 5 years of experience OR 7 years of related work experience without a degree. Ability to obtain & maintain a DEA suitability clearance.
